Let me see if I can help, because you are confused. First all the rooms (except the Deluxe Rooms or Suites) at Wilderness Lodge are Standard Rooms, which is what you keep asking about...Other then the Deluxe Rooms, Suites and rooms that are Club level (concierge) You book by VIEW and rather you want Bunk Beds. Standard View Woods View Woods View with Bunk Beds Courtyard View Courtyard View with Bunk Beds If you are in fact asking about a room you have booked that has a Standard View the lest expensive room at the Lodge. These rooms only have 2 Queen Beds, and are located on Floors 4, 5 & 6. On the North (MK) side of the Wilderness Lodge, they face the service area. There are also 9 Standard View rooms located on the South side of the 4th floor that overlook the lobby and lookout to roof peaks. So you'll either have a view overlooking roof peaks or the service area. The information on the first page of this thread is from personal experience and I have stayed in many of the rooms at the Lodge. If I book a standard view room I request the North Wing on the 5th floor, while there is a view of the service area if you look straight down, you may also have a view of the Magic Kingdom and great views of the fireworks at night.
